Abstract
The invention discloses a method for applying a hydraulic material cleaning machine. The method includes steps of A, connecting a main water inlet pipe with an external water supply rubber pipe and positioning a cleaning barrel at a horizontal location; B, placing fodder with sand and impurities into the cleaning barrel and arranging fodder which is not cleaned on the upper portion of a filter plate in an inner cavity of the cleaning barrel; C, starting an external water supply valve, and injecting water flow into the cleaning barrel from a left water inlet pipe and a right water inlet pipe simultaneously; D, enabling a left hydraulic rod and a right hydraulic rod to alternately reciprocate up and down, enabling fodder materials in the cleaning barrel to be collided with each other and impacting the fodder on a filter screen by water flow back and forth; E, opening a left water outlet pipe and a right water outlet pipe after the sand and the impurities on the fodder materials are thoroughly cleaned, and simultaneously draining sewage. The water flow flows into the barrel. The method has the advantages that the hydraulic material cleaning machine implemented in the method is simple in structure and high in strength, and the fodder can stay in the barrel for a long time; the hydraulic material cleaning machine is compact in structure and can swing left and right, and collision between the fodder and impact of the water flow can be sufficiently utilized, so that the fodder can be cleaned.

Background technology:
At present, existing cylinder material washing machine is primarily of cylindrical shell, transmission device, bracing frame composition, and cylindrical shell is arranged on bracing frame, drives barrel body rotation by transmission device, carries out feed cleaning.It is short to there is feed time of staying in cylinder in cylinder material washing machine, cannot thoroughly clean the silt be attached on feed.For solving this technical problem, need to occur that a kind of using method is simple, the product structure of use is simple, and intensity is high and feed time of staying in cylinder is long, compact conformation, vacillates now to the left, now to the right and makes full use of the using method that collision between feed and water impact clean a kind of hydraulic pressure supplies cleaner of feed.

To achieve these goals, the invention provides a kind of using method of hydraulic pressure supplies cleaner, wherein, comprise the steps:
A, first main water inlet tube to be connected with outside water supply sebific duct, to start left hydraulic jack and right hydraulic jack, make left hydraulic stem and right hydraulic stem be retractable to equal height, make to wash barrel and be horizontal;
B, open left turnover bin gate and right turnover bin gate, the feed containing silt impurity is put into and washes barrel, make the feed without cleaning be placed in the filter top washing barrel inner chamber;
C, close left turnover bin gate and right turnover bin gate, open outside water supply water valve, clean water is flowed into by main water inlet tube, and the left water inlet pipe of runner and right water inlet pipe, current are injected from left water inlet pipe and right water inlet pipe simultaneously and washes in barrel;
D, control left hydraulic jack and right hydraulic jack respectively, make left hydraulic jack and the shifting each other reciprocating motion of right hydraulic jack, make that left hydraulic stem and right hydraulic stem are shifting each other back and forth to move up and down, and then to make to wash barrel take center rotational shaft as the center of circle, rotate up and down, the feed washed in barrel is collided with each other, makes current in the inflow bucket feedstuff back and forth on impact filtration plate;
E, after the silt impurity on feedstuff is cleaned, control left hydraulic stem and right hydraulic stem is retractable to equal height, make to wash barrel and be horizontal, open left outlet pipe and right outlet pipe, drain the sewage away simultaneously.
A kind of hydraulic pressure supplies cleaner that using method of the present invention uses, comprise left hydraulic jack, left hydraulic stem, wash barrel, left water inlet pipe, main water inlet tube, right water inlet pipe, screen pack, right outlet pipe, right hydraulic stem, right hydraulic jack, center rotational shaft, support, filter and left outlet pipe, wherein, described pedestal upper end is welded with center rotational shaft, center rotational shaft is provided with further and washes barrel, wash in the middle part of barrel inner chamber and be provided with filter, filter is welded and fixed with washing in the middle part of barrel inner chamber, wash barrel to be connected with center rotational shaft axle, wash barrel top and be welded with left water inlet pipe and right water inlet pipe near the position at two ends, left water inlet pipe is connected with right water inlet pipe, UNICOM middle position is provided with main water inlet tube, main water inlet tube and left water inlet pipe, right water inlet pipe is connected.
Described barrel bottom of washing is welded with left outlet pipe and right outlet pipe near the position at two ends, washing barrel inner chamber on the horizontal level of left outlet pipe and right outlet pipe is welded with screen pack, wash in the middle part of barrel inner chamber and be provided with filter, filter is welded and fixed with washing in the middle part of barrel inner chamber, wash barrel bottom and be welded with left rotary shaft and right spindle respectively near the position at two ends, the tip position of washing two ends, barrel left and right is welded with left hinge and right hinge respectively, on left hinge and right hinge, axle is connected with left turnover bin gate and right turnover bin gate respectively, left rotary shaft and right spindle lower end vertically over glaze are connected with left hydraulic stem and right hydraulic stem, left hydraulic stem and right hydraulic stem lower end are socketed respectively and are connected with left hydraulic jack and right hydraulic jack.
